In international relations, constructivism is a social theory that asserts that significant aspects of international relations are shaped by ideational factors (which are historically and socially constructed), not simply material factors. Up until recently populism could be defined as an essentially contested concept, but in recent years a growing consensus has emerged on an ideational approach, which sees populism, first and foremost, as a set of ideas focused on a fundamental opposition between the people and the elite. The ideational theory, in contrast, places more importance on subjective factors such as human ideas and attitudes towards family and lifestyle than on material conditions as the determinants of demographic behaviour. The ideational definition is closely related to the pioneering discursive approach of Laclau ( 1977, 2005 ).
